——报错笔记
报错:Web server failed to start. Port 8080 was already in use.
原因:这个错误表明两个 Spring Boot 项目都尝试在默认的端口 8080 上启动内嵌的 Web 服务器(通常是 Tomcat),但由于端口冲突,第二个项目无法启动。就是我两个springboot项目都选择了web依赖,导致启动时冲突了
方法:
修改端口号:在每个 Spring Boot 项目的配置文件(通常是 application.properties
或 application.yml
)中,将内嵌 Web 服务器的端口号配置为不同的值,以避免冲突。例如,一个项目使用 8080,另一个项目可以使用 8081 或其他未占用的端口。
server.port: 8081